    What Exactly Is Asbestos?

    For those who are unfamiliar, asbestos is actually a group of minerals. These are naturally occurring and are used within insulation in order to protect against corrosion and heat.

    More specifically, asbestos includes amosite, actinolite, and chrysotile. Even if these materials have been chemically altered in some form, they are still considered asbestos. As you might suspect, the use of asbestos is most common within the construction industry.

    What Are the Associated Health Risks?

    The primary risk of coming into contact with asbestos is that it is too small to be seen without the proper equipment.

    So, you likely will not be aware that you are exposed to it. Over time, though, this substance can build up in the lungs and cause scar tissue to form.

    This can lead to the development of a large number of diseases and disorders, including cancer. In general, these conditions do not arise until a much later date. Combined with the fact that asbestos is invisible to the naked eye, you could be doing damage to your body without being aware of it.

    How Can I Recognize It?

    There is a handful of scenarios in which you will likely be exposed to asbestos. This includes renovating an attic in a home, drilling into drywall, and removing vinyl floor tiles.

    In some cases, it can also involve popcorn ceiling removal. For more industrial settings, cutting through the insulation on pipes could cause the same situation to occur. This becomes more likely if the property or structure was created decades ago, as asbestos regulations used to be far looser.
